The Hidden Epidemic of Workplace Bullying in America

Workplace bullying isn’t just a toxic office dynamic, it’s a widespread, underreported crisis affecting more than 74 million American workers. With 61% of bullies holding supervisory roles and 62% of victims ultimately leaving their jobs, this isn’t poor management—it’s workplace abuse.

The damage goes beyond job dissatisfaction. It leads to anxiety, depression, PTSD, and long-term career disruption. Yet most companies still treat it as a personality conflict, not a systemic problem.
